PlanFIRST is a landmark Government initiative
to modernise the plan making system across NSW to
deliver better outcomes and a sustainable future
for NSW. It is about a whole-of-government approach,
including local government, to make sure that plans
are more effective in coordinating actions and giving
confidence in the future.
In September 2002, the Minister for Planning, the
Hon Andrew Refshauge MP identified the Northern
Rivers for regional strategy work, as part of the
implementation of planFIRST. This means that the
Northern Rivers Regional Strategy is currently in
a process of transition to planFIRST.
Preparation for this transition has involved:
• Identification of issues and needs for the
Regional Forum to consider (including research requirements,
suggestions concerning technical sub-committees
etc);
• Exchange of NRRS information, materials
and assets;
• Strengthening the valley committee structure
in preparation for the new work program;
• A celebration to recognise the conversion
from the NRRS to PlanFIRST;
• Consolidation of NRRS information, consultation
findings and research; and
• Finalisation of the following projects:
• Sustainable Designer’s Toolkit
• Social Impact Assessment Information package
• Residential Release Strategies Spreadsheet
System
• Extractive Resources Model Conditions
• Villages Research Projects; and
• Information guide and gap analysis for the
Richmond Valley Passenger Transport Project.
A Regional Forum is in the process of being established
in the Northern Rivers to provide the Minister for
Planning with advice on the development of the regional
strategy.
